source: projects/specs/trunk/a/at-spi2-atk/at-spi2-atk-vl.spec @ 12444

Revision 12444, 8.5 KB checked in by tomop, 4 years ago (diff)

updated 9 packages

at-spi2-atk-2.34.2-1

at-spi2-core-2.36.0-1

atk-2.36.0-1

atkmm-2.28.0-1

cairomm-1.12.0-3

glibmm-2.64.2-1

gtkmm3-3.24.2-1

libsigc++-2.10.3-1

pangomm-2.42.1-1

Line 
1%define build_compat32 %{?_with_compat32:1}%{!?_with_compat32:0}
2
3Name:           at-spi2-atk
4Version:        2.34.2
5Release:        1%{?_dist_release}
6Summary:        A GTK+ module that bridges ATK to D-Bus at-spi
7Vendor:         Project Vine
8Distribution:   Vine Linux
9
10License:        LGPLv2+
11URL:            https://www.freedesktop.org/wiki/Accessibility/AT-SPI2/
12%global         shortver %(echo %{version} | sed -e 's/\.[0-9]*$//')
13Source0:        https://download.gnome.org/sources/%{name}/%{shortver}/%{name}-%{version}.tar.xz
14
15BuildRequires:  meson
16BuildRequires:  intltool
17BuildRequires:  at-spi2-core-devel
18BuildRequires:  dbus-devel
19BuildRequires:  dbus-glib-devel
20BuildRequires:  glib2-devel
21BuildRequires:  libxml2-devel
22BuildRequires:  atk-devel
23BuildRequires:  libSM-devel
24
25Requires:       at-spi2-core
26
27
28%description
29at-spi allows assistive technologies to access GTK-based
30applications. Essentially it exposes the internals of applications for
31automation, so tools such as screen readers, magnifiers, or even
32scripting interfaces can query and interact with GUI controls.
33
34This version of at-spi is a major break from previous versions.
35It has been completely rewritten to use D-Bus rather than
36ORBIT / CORBA for its transport protocol.
37
38This package includes a gtk-module that bridges ATK to the new
39D-Bus based at-spi.
40
41
42%package        devel
43Summary:        Development files for %{name}
44Summary(ja):    %{name} の開発ファイル
45Group:          Development/Libraries
46Requires:       %{name} = %{version}-%{release}
47Requires:       glib2-devel
48
49%description    devel
50The %{name}-devel package contains libraries and header files for
51developing applications that use %{name}.
52
53# compat32
54%package -n compat32-%{name}
55Summary:  A GTK+ module that bridges ATK to D-Bus at-spi
56Group:    System Environment/Libraries
57Requires: %{name} = %{version}-%{release}
58Requires: compat32-at-spi2-core
59
60%description -n compat32-%{name}
61at-spi allows assistive technologies to access GTK-based
62applications. Essentially it exposes the internals of applications for
63automation, so tools such as screen readers, magnifiers, or even
64scripting interfaces can query and interact with GUI controls.
65
66This version of at-spi is a major break from previous versions.
67It has been completely rewritten to use D-Bus rather than
68ORBIT / CORBA for its transport protocol.
69
70This package includes a gtk-module that bridges ATK to the new
71D-Bus based at-spi.
72
73
74%package -n compat32-%{name}-devel
75Summary: Development package for %{name}
76Group:   Development/Libraries
77Requires: compat32-%{name} = %{version}-%{release}
78Requires: %{name}-devel = %{version}-%{release}
79Requires: compat32-at-spi2-core-devel
80
81%description -n compat32-%{name}-devel
82Files for development with compat32-%{name}.
83
84
85%prep
86%setup -q
87
88%build
89%meson \
90        -Ddisable_p2p=false \
91        -Dtests=false
92%meson_build
93
94
95%install
96%meson_install
97
98
99%post -p /sbin/ldconfig
100
101%postun -p /sbin/ldconfig
102
103%post -n compat32-%{name} -p /sbin/ldconfig
104
105%postun -n compat32-%{name} -p /sbin/ldconfig
106
107
108%files
109%defattr(-,root,root,-)
110%license COPYING
111%doc AUTHORS README
112%{_libdir}/libatk-bridge-2.0.so.*
113%dir %{_libdir}/gtk-2.0
114%dir %{_libdir}/gtk-2.0/modules
115%{_libdir}/gtk-2.0/modules/libatk-bridge.so
116%dir %{_libdir}/gnome-settings-daemon-3.0
117%dir %{_libdir}/gnome-settings-daemon-3.0/gtk-modules/
118%{_libdir}/gnome-settings-daemon-3.0/gtk-modules/at-spi2-atk.desktop
119
120%files devel
121%defattr(-,root,root,-)
122%{_includedir}/%{name}
123%{_libdir}/libatk-bridge-2.0.so
124%{_libdir}/pkgconfig/atk-bridge-2.0.pc
125
126# compat32
127%if %{build_compat32}
128%files -n compat32-%{name}
129%defattr(-,root,root,-)
130%{_libdir}/libatk-bridge-2.0.so.*
131
132%files -n compat32-%{name}-devel
133%defattr(-,root,root,-)
134%{_libdir}/libatk-bridge-2.0.so
135%endif
136
137
138%changelog
139* Sat Aug 01 2020 Tomohiro "Tomo-p" KATO <tomop@teamgedoh.net> 2.34.2-1
140- new upstream release.
141
142* Sun Feb 25 2018 Tomohiro "Tomo-p" KATO <tomop@teamgedoh.net> 2.26.1-2
143- rebuilt for compat32-*.
144
145* Mon Jan 08 2018 Tomohiro "Tomo-p" KATO <tomop@teamgedoh.net> 2.26.1-1
146- new upstream release
147
148* Thu Jul 14 2016 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.20.1-1
149- new upstream release
150
151* Thu Oct 29 2015 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.18.1-1
152- new upstream release
153
154* Sat Mar 28 2015 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.16.0-1
155- new upstream release
156
157* Fri Sep 26 2014 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.14.1-1
158- new upstream release
159
160* Sat Apr 19 2014 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.12.1-1
161- new upstream release
162
163* Fri Mar 28 2014 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.12.0-1
164- new upstream release
165
166* Sun Nov 24 2013 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.10.2-1
167- new upstream release
168
169* Sat Oct 26 2013 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.10.0-1
170- new upstream release
171
172* Wed Apr 17 2013 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.8.1-1
173- new upstream release
174
175* Wed Nov 14 2012 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.6.2-1
176- new upstream release
177
178* Wed Oct 17 2012 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.6.1-1
179- new upstream release
180
181* Sat Oct 06 2012 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.6.0-2
182- create compat32 sub packages
183
184* Wed Sep 26 2012 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.6.0-1
185- new upstream release
186- remove BuildRequires: gtk2-devel
187- create -devel subpackage
188
189* Sun Apr 08 2012 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.4.0-1
190- new upstream release
191
192* Wed Nov 16 2011 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.2.2-1
193- new upstream release
194
195* Fri Oct 21 2011 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.2.1-1
196- new upstream release
197
198* Thu Sep 29 2011 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.2.0-1
199- new upstream release
200
201* Fri Sep 23 2011 Yoji TOYODA <bsyamato@sea.plala.or.jp> 2.1.92-1
202- initial build for Vine Linux
203
204
205* Mon Sep  5 2011 Matthias Clasen <mclasen@redhat.com> 2.1.91-1
206- Update to 2.1.91
207
208* Mon Jul 25 2011 Matthias Clasen <mclasen@redhat.com> 2.1.4-1
209- Update to 2.1.4
210
211* Tue Apr 26 2011 Matthias Clasen <mclasen@redhat.com> 2.0.1-1
212- Update to 2.0.1
213
214* Mon Apr  4 2011 Matthias Clasen <mclasen@redhat.com> 2.0.0-1
215- Update to 2.0.0
216
217* Fri Mar 25 2011 Matthias Clasen <mclasen@redhat.com> 1.91.93-1
218- Update to 1.91.93
219
220* Mon Mar 21 2011 Matthias Clasen <mclasen@redhat.com> 1.91.92-1
221- Update to 1.91.92
222
223* Mon Mar  7 2011 Matthias Clasen <mclasen@redhat.com> 1.91.91-1
224- Update to 1.91.91
225
226* Mon Feb 21 2011 Matthias Clasen <mclasen@redhat.com> 1.91.90-1
227- Update to 1.91.90
228
229* Mon Feb 07 2011 Fedora Release Engineering <rel-eng@lists.fedoraproject.org> - 1.91.6-4
230- Rebuilt for https://fedoraproject.org/wiki/Fedora_15_Mass_Rebuild
231
232* Mon Feb 07 2011 Bastien Nocera <bnocera@redhat.com> 1.91.6-3
233- Add upstream patches to fix crashers
234
235* Fri Feb 04 2011 Bastien Nocera <bnocera@redhat.com> 1.91.6-2
236- Revert crashy part of 1.91.6 release
237
238* Wed Feb  2 2011 Christopher Aillon <caillon@redhat.com> - 1.91.6-1
239- Update to 1.91.6
240
241* Tue Jan 11 2011 Matthias Clasen <mclasen@redhat.com> - 1.91.5-1
242- Update to 1.91.5
243
244* Thu Nov 11 2010 Matthias Clasen <mclasen@redhat.com> - 1.91.2-1
245- Update to 1.91.2
246
247* Mon Oct  4 2010 Matthias Clasen <mclasen@redhat.com> - 1.91.0-1
248- Update to 1.91.0
249
250* Wed Sep 29 2010 Matthias Clasen <mclasen@redhat.com> - 0.4.0-1
251- Update to 0.4.0
252
253* Tue Aug 31 2010 Matthias Clasen <mclasen@redhat.com> - 0.3.91.1-1
254- Update to 0.3.91.1
255
256* Fri Aug 27 2010 Matthias Clasen <mclasen@redhat.com> - 0.3.90-2
257- Make the gtk module resident to prevent crashes
258
259* Wed Aug 18 2010 Matthias Clasen <mclasen@redhat.com> - 0.3.90-1
260- Update to 0.3.90
261
262* Mon Aug  2 2010 Matthias Clasen <mclasen@redhat.com> - 0.3.6-1
263- Update to 0.3.6
264
265* Mon Jul 12 2010 Matthias Clasen <mclasen@redhat.com> - 0.3.5-1
266- Update to 0.3.5
267
268* Tue Jun 29 2010 Matthias Clasen <mclasen@redhat.com> - 0.3.4-1
269- Update to 0.3.4
270
271* Tue Jun  8 2010 Matthias Clasen <mclasen@redhat.com> - 0.3.3-1
272- Update to 0.3.3
273- Include gtk3 module
274- Drop gtk deps, since we don't want to depend on both gtk2 and gtk3;
275  instead own the directories
276
277* Tue Jun  1 2010 Matthias Clasen <mclasen@redhat.com> - 0.3.2-2
278- Don't relocate the dbus a11y stack
279
280* Fri May 28 2010 Matthias Clasen <mclasen@redhat.com> - 0.3.2-1
281- Update to 0.3.2
282
283* Sat May 15 2010 Matthias Clasen <mclasen@redhat.com> - 0.3.1-1
284- Update to 0.3.1
285
286* Tue Mar 30 2010 Matthias Clasen <mclasen@redhat.com> - 0.1.8-1
287- Update to 0.1.8
288
289* Sat Feb 20 2010 Matthias Clasen <mclasen@redhat.com> - 0.1.7-1
290- Update to 0.1.7
291
292* Wed Feb 10 2010 Tomas Bzatek <tbzatek@redhat.com> - 0.1.6-1
293- Update to 0.1.6
294
295* Sat Jan 16 2010 Matthias Clasen <mclasen@redhat.com> - 0.1.5-1
296- Update to 0.1.5
297
298* Tue Dec 22 2009 Matthias Clasen <mclasen@redhat.com> - 0.1.4-1
299- Update to 0.1.4
300
301* Sat Dec  5 2009 Matthias Clasen <mclasen@redhat.com> - 0.1.3-1
302- Initial packaging
Note: See TracBrowser for help on using the repository browser.